**Vendor note: Inkmill markdown pipeline**

Rendering for Parchway docs is outsourced to Inkmill under an annual contract, renewing each March. They handle sanitization and PDF export; we own the upload queue. SLA: 4-hour response on rendering failures. Escalate only after two failed retries. Their support desk is reachable at the address below.

billing contact of hahaf-baguf = zorael.tammir.jorius@sivrelhq.internal

- [ ] Step 7: Archive cold storage buckets (Glacierline tier). Confirm both ceremony witnesses are present, verify bucket manifests match the Oxbow ledger, then seal the archive key shares. Plugin authors may observe but not handle shares. Once sealed, the archive index itself is encrypted and can only be reopened with the passphrase below.

vault phrase of badup-hahig = tamael-aldael-kelmir-istael-fenok-istwyn-tamius-jorath-oliion

Subject: Sweeper cut-over complete — summary for Thursday's sync

Team, the Gravewind retention sweeper cut-over finished Monday night without data loss. We drained the old sweeper, verified the ledger checksums on both sides, and enabled the new deletion scheduler in shadow mode for six hours before going live. Two anomalies: a duplicate tombstone batch (harmless, deduped) and one tenant with a legacy hold flag, now migrated. Old sweeper stays read-only until Friday. For the record, the production configuration we went live with is below.

config for tagep-yajef:
ulawyn:
  log_level: error
  metrics_host: metrics.ulawyn.lumiclabs.internal
  pin: 0564
  pool_size: 32